Technical Instructor Competitive, Based on experience Crawley, England, GB Full Time, Permanent We are seeking a Technical Instructor to design and deliver high-quality maintenance training for customers supporting simulator devices. This is an exciting opportunity to join an agile, global aviation environment committed to innovation, customer service, and safer skies. In this role, you will work closely with the Head of Customer Support to create and deliver customer-focused technical training, both in-house and at customer sites in the UK and overseas. You will also support the development, publication, and validation of technical documentation and electronic learning content, ensuring training materials reflect the correct customer configuration and remain accurate, practical, and easy to use. The role You will be responsible for creating and delivering maintenance training to a diverse customer base, adapting your approach to suit different cultures, backgrounds, and operational needs. You’ll be expected to work independently, manage your own workload, and raise technical, schedule, or resource risks early. When required, you will also contribute to the Electronic Documentation Facility content, helping to build clear, customer-facing maintenance information. Key responsibilities Design and deliver innovative, customer-focused technical training. Analyse aircraft, equipment, and wiring drawings to support training content. Develop and validate course material and lesson plans using the latest baseline content. Maintain detailed training diaries and documentation. Support the creation and publication of technical documentation and E-Learning content. Act as a technical expert within the instructional team for your assigned system or subject area. Work collaboratively to help define and improve departmental processes. Manage your own workload effectively and deliver within budget and timescales. Raise issues, risks, and technical challenges promptly and professionally. Represent company values: Customer First, Own It, Move Fast, and Speak with Candour.What we’re looking for Qualified civilian or military instructor with at least 2 years’ experience delivering technical instruction.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Degree in a maths, science, or engineering-related subject, or equivalent industry experience. At least 4 years’ relevant industry experience, or 2 years’ technical experience in the associated discipline. Strong technical problem-solving ability. Good computing knowledge, including hardware and Windows/Linux operating systems. Willingness to work shifts and unsociable hours, including travel within the UK and overseas.Benefits 25 days’ holiday plus bank holidays, increasing with service. Buy/sell up to 5 days holiday. Private medical insurance, with optional family cover. Pension with up to 7% employer contribution. Life assurance up to 4x salary, flexible up to 10x. Group income protection. Optional extras including dental, gym membership, critical illness cover, and cycle to work. Employee assistance programme for wellbeing support. Subsidised staff restaurant. Staff car park with EV charging.Location and eligibility This role is based at the London Training Centre, Crawley, England, GB and requires the right to work in the UK
